Sec. 7. A lease entered into under this chapter may provide that as a part of the lease rental for the school building or buildings the lessee or lessees shall:

(1) pay all taxes and assessments levied against or on account of the leased property;

(2) maintain insurance on the leased property for the benefit of the lessor corporation; and

(3) assume all responsibilities for repair and alterations of the leased property during the term of the lease.
